Bi-state Primary Care Assoc Inc is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Bow, New Hampshire, registered in 1990, with $6,467,948 in FY2024 revenue. CharityIndex grades it B.

Revenue grew from $3.9M (FY2013) to $6.5M (FY2024) across 12 reported years.

9 grants to Bi-state Primary Care Assoc Inc totaling $584K, reported by foundations on their Schedule I filings.
| Grantmaker | Purpose | Year | Amount |
|---|---|---|---|
| President and Fellows of Harvard College | Sponsored research sub-award | 2023 | $139,961 |
| New Hampshire Charitable Foundation | To support efforts that engage the healthcare workforce coalition | 2023 | $20,000 |
| President and Fellows of Harvard College | Sponsored research sub-award | 2022 | $59,211 |
| New Hampshire Charitable Foundation | For unrestricted operating support | 2021 | $60,000 |
| President and Fellows of Harvard College | Sponsored research sub-award | 2021 | $10,741 |
| Pew Charitable Trusts | Policy | 2020 | $203,147 |
| President and Fellows of Harvard College | Sponsored research sub-award | 2020 | $5,698 |
| New Hampshire Charitable Foundation | For unrestricted operating support in new hampshire | 2018 | $60,000 |
| New Hampshire Charitable Foundation | For social media for community health centers - get educated, organized, going | 2014 | $25,000 |
